Frequently Asked Questions

What is Broadmedia's market cap?

Broadmedia (4347) has a market capitalization of approximately ¥12.8B, trading at ¥1797.00 on the JPX. Market cap moves with the live share price.

What is Broadmedia's P/E ratio?

Broadmedia's trailing twelve-month P/E ratio is 16.4x, with a price-to-book (P/B) of 2.5x. Valuation multiples are best compared with Communication Services sector peers rather than read in isolation.

How profitable is Broadmedia?

Broadmedia runs a net profit margin of 5.0%, a gross margin of 38.5%, and an operating margin of 6.7%. Margins and ROE indicate how efficiently the business converts sales into profit and shareholder returns.

How much revenue does Broadmedia generate?

Broadmedia reported revenue of ¥15.8B for fiscal year 2025, with net income of ¥782M and earnings per share (EPS) of 109.74. SniperIQ tracks the full 8-quarter revenue and margin trend on the research dashboard.

Does Broadmedia pay a dividend?

Broadmedia offers a trailing dividend yield of about 3.3%. Dividend sustainability depends on payout ratio, free cash flow, and earnings stability — all tracked in SniperIQ's fundamentals view.

Is Broadmedia financially healthy?

Broadmedia carries a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.19x and a current ratio of 1.52x, with a market beta of 0.11. Lower leverage and a current ratio above 1.0 generally signal a stronger balance sheet.
